UNPKG

welcome-ui

Version:

Customizable design system with react • styled-components • styled-system and ariakit.

23 lines (22 loc) 2.01 kB
import { WuiProps } from '../System'; import * as Ariakit from '@ariakit/react'; export declare const Radio: import('styled-components/dist/types').IStyledComponentBase<"web", import('styled-components').FastOmit<Ariakit.RadioOptions<"input"> & Omit<Omit<import('react').DetailedHTMLProps<import('react').InputHTMLAttributes<HTMLInputElement>, HTMLInputElement>, "ref"> & { ref?: import('react').Ref<HTMLInputElement>; }, keyof Ariakit.RadioOptions<T>> & { [index: `data-${string}`]: unknown; }, never>> & string & Omit<(props: Ariakit.RadioProps) => import('react').ReactElement<any, string | import('react').JSXElementConstructor<any>>, keyof import('react').Component<any, {}, any>>; export declare const Label: import('styled-components/dist/types').IStyledComponentBase<"web", import('styled-components/dist/types').Substitute<import('styled-components').FastOmit<import('react').DetailedHTMLProps<import('react').LabelHTMLAttributes<HTMLLabelElement>, HTMLLabelElement>, keyof import('@xstyled/system').SystemProps<import('@xstyled/system').Theme>> & import('@xstyled/system').SystemProps<import('@xstyled/system').Theme>, Partial<{ hasIcon?: boolean; iconPlacement?: "both" | "left" | "right"; isClearable?: boolean; size: import('../../utils').Size; transparent?: boolean; variant: "danger" | "success" | "warning"; }> & { checked?: boolean; disabled?: boolean; disabledIcon?: React.ReactElement; flexDirection?: WuiProps["flexDirection"]; }>> & string; export declare const Input: import('styled-components/dist/types').IStyledComponentBase<"web", import('styled-components').FastOmit<import('react').DetailedHTMLProps<import('react').HTMLAttributes<HTMLDivElement>, HTMLDivElement>, never>> & string; export declare const Content: import('styled-components/dist/types').IStyledComponentBase<"web", import('styled-components').FastOmit<import('react').DetailedHTMLProps<import('react').HTMLAttributes<HTMLDivElement>, HTMLDivElement>, never>> & string;